Analyze Phylogenetic Trees with ETE
Phylogenetic tree work often needs format conversion, taxonomy lookup, event analysis, and clear figures. This skill guides Claude, Codex, and Claude Code through ETE workflows and helper scripts.

Most static findings are false positives caused by markdown code fences, inline backticks, public NCBI taxonomy identifiers, and documented ETE cache paths. The confirmed static risk is limited to two sudo apt-get installation examples that could run with elevated privileges if copied. A semantic content concern remains because the skill asks the assistant to promote the author’s hosted platform during complex workflows.
These are real local capabilities that may be expected for this skill, so they require review but are not counted as confirmed malicious behavior.

Clean, reroot, prune, and standardize Newick trees before downstream phylogenomic work.
Use PhyloTree workflows to detect duplication and speciation events in gene families.
Style trees and export PDF, SVG, or PNG figures with branch support and custom labels.
